Ireland - Barley Producer Price Index

Since 2011, Ireland Barley Producer Price Index decreased by 9.2% year on year. With 114.66 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100 in 2016, the country was ranked number 73 among other countries in Barley Producer Price Index. Ireland is overtaken by Estonia, which was ranked number 72 at 120.28 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100 and is followed by Slovakia with 113.07 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100. Belarus topped the ranking with 1,546.59 Indexes 2004–2006 = 100 in 2017, a growth of 30.5% compared to 2016. Syria, Ukraine and Iran resp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Syria witnessed the best average annual growth at +39.3% per year, while Bolivia was the worst growing country at -11.1% per year.
